Objective:To observe the clinical effect of laser acupuncture in the treatment of dry eye,and to explore the modulation effect of laser acupuncture on TLR4 signaling pathway in dry eye.Methods:A total of 60 patients(120 eyes)with dry eyes were selected from the TCM ophthalmology clinic of Shanxi Eye Hospital from June 2019 to December 2019.They were randomly divided into laser acupuncture group and sodium hyaluronate eye drop group(control group),with 30 cases(60 eyes)in each group.Laser acupuncture group:laser acupuncture treatment(laser wavelength: 650 nm,output power: 5m W),20 min each time,once a day,one course of treatment for 10 days;Control group: Sodium hyaluronate eye drops on eyes,3 times a day,1-2 drops each time,10 days a course of treatment,both groups were treated for 3 courses.Subjective symptom score,lacrimal river height,tear film rupture time,corneal fluorencein staining,serum TLR4,My D88,NF-κB,NLRP3,NLRP6 expression levels were observed before and after treatment.Results:1.Subjective symptoms: Both treatment methods could improve the subjective symptoms of patients with dry eye,and the differences before and after treatment were statistically significant(all P < 0.05).There was no statistical significance in subjective symptom improvement between the laser acupuncture group and the control group(P>0.05).2.Height of lacrimal river: there was statistically significant difference in the height of lacrimal river between the two groups before and after treatment(P < 0.05).There was no statistical significance in the control group(P > 0.05).After treatment,the laser acupuncture group and the control group had statistical significance(P < 0.05).3.Tear film rupture time: The tear film rupture time of the two groups before and after treatment showed statistically significant difference in the laser acupuncture group(P <0.05);There was no statistical significance in the control group(P > 0.05).There was statistically significant difference between the two groups after treatment(P < 0.05).4.Corneal luciferin staining: The corneal luciferin staining scores in both groups were lower after treatment than before treatment,with statistical significance(P < 0.05).There was no significant difference in the improvement of corneal fluorescein staining between the laser acupuncture group and the control group after treatment(P > 0.05).5.Comparison of serum TLR4,My D88,NF-κB,NLRP3 and NLRP6 expression levels: There was no statistical significance in serum TLR4,My D88 and NF-κB expression levels of laser acupuncture group before and after treatment(P > 0.05).NLRP3 and NLRP6 were statistically significant(P < 0.05).The expression levels of TLR4,My D88,NF-κB,NLRP3 and NLRP6 in serum of control group were not significantly different before and after treatment(P > 0.05).After treatment,the expression levels of NLRP3 and NLRP6 in 2 groups were significantly different(P < 0.05).6.Clinical efficacy: In the laser acupuncture group,after treatment,the apparent efficiency was 16.67%,the effective rate was 61.67%,and the total effective rate was78.33%.In the sodium hyaluronate eye drops group,the effective rate was 13.33%,45.00% and 58.33%.The difference between the two groups was statistically significant(P< 0.05),and the clinical effect of laser acupuncture on dry eye was better than that of the control group.Conclusion:Laser acupuncture can improve the subjective symptoms of patients with dry eyes,increase the height of lacrimal river,prolong the mean tear film rupture time,repair the damage of corneal epithelium,and improve the expression levels of serum NLRP3 and NLRP6.Laser acupuncture of dry eye clinical efficacy is better than the control group,but laser acupuncture in the treatment of parameters and instrument design still need a lot of optimization and adjustment,its mechanism also needs to be further explored.It is believed that through continuous optimization,laser acupuncture will have broad application prospects. |
